US Army Base Issues Warning Over Potential Shooting Threat Related to ‘Joker’

The U.S. Army Base at Fort Sill Oklahoma has warned commanders of a potential threat of violence at an upcoming showing of Warner Bros. “Joker,” citing an intelligence bulletin about “a credible potential mass shooting to occur at an unknown movie theater.” The memo, sent on Monday, became public after it was later posted to a Facebook page popular with enlisted Air Force personnel, Stars and Stripes reported. It cites an intelligence bulletin posted by Travis County, Texas sheriff’s office working with the local FBI field office, which it says discovered “disturbing and very specific chatter on the dark web.”…

Fox News Apologizes After Guest Calls Teen Climate Activist ‘Mentally Ill Swedish Child’ Live on Air

Fox News apologized Monday night after an on-air guest referred to Greta Thunberg, a teenage climate activist from Sweden, as a “mentally ill Swedish child” and repeated a conspiracy theory about her during a live appearance on “The Story.” Michael Knowles, who hosts a podcast for The Daily Wire, was on to discuss Thunberg, who came to the U.S last week to participate in the youth climate strike and addressed the United Nations about climate change on Monday. During the segment, Knowles disparaged climate activists, saying, “if it were about science it would be led by scientists, rather than by…

‘Roma,’ ‘Mission: Impossible’ Win Awards From Location Managers Guild

“Roma” and “Mission: Impossible – Fallout” have won the top film awards from the 2019 Location Managers Guild International’s LMGI Awards, which were handed out in Los Angeles on Saturday night. “Mission: Impossible,” which was shot in France, the U.K., Abu Dhabi, Norway and New Zealand, won in the Outstanding Locations in a Contemporary Feature category. Alfonso Cuaron’s “Roma,” shot entirely in Mexico City, won for Outstanding Locations in a Period Feature. Voting in the television categories followed suit, with the contemporary award going to an action-packed franchise, “Tom Clancy’s Jack Ryan” (shot in Montreal, Morocco, France and Washington, D.C.)…

Bill Maher Offers New Definition of ‘Trump Derangement Syndrome’

Bill Maher closed “Real Time” Friday night by flipping the definition of “Trump Derangement Syndrome” — a term used by conservatives like Tucker Carlson and Sean Hannity to describe Donald Trump critics. The Fox News personalities regularly bring up “Trump Derangement Syndrome” in their shows to argue that Trump critics are so maddened by their hatred for the president that they can’t think rationally.
